An Electrical Installation Condition Report (or EICR) is a legal document that evaluates the condition and safety of electrical installations. This is done by a Part P Registered electrician with years of experience and expertise in electrical installations. They will check the electrical wiring and appliances, as well as the earthing and circuit loading, as well as any other issues that may cause harm to the building or the home. This document is required by mortgage lenders. An EICR will identify any issues that require to be addressed or rectified, and will verify that the property is in compliance with legal requirements.
The electrical wiring inside your house or building will gradually become less effective as time passes. Incorrectly insulated wiring can cause electrical shorts or even fires.
